TNT North 8103-127 Avenue Suite 7
(780) 457-9905
Monday 6-11pm
TNT LUX 11315 174 Street, 2nd Floor
(780) 758-5899
Thursday 6-11pm
Friday 6-11pm
Walk In's Are Most Welcome! Come meet me on one of my available shifts above! I look forward to seeing you soon!
Text Me Today!